m.hache posted:

Any idea what determines your trophy?

I've cleared entire floors perfectly and still came out with a Bronze.

Also, any way to repair spells? I had 5* WallBreak spells and apparently they break after X amount of uses (Would have been good to know)

Bronze = finish the dungeon
Silver = all floors perfect
Gold = got all unique loot (will need a few runs and some luck)

For spells you'll unlock the item shop which will let you buy spells you've already found/used for gold but can't repair them. Broken spells are used in a few item upgrade recipes though.

Items seem to have an increasing chance to break starting after 4-5 uses as indicated by a glowing red outline.

I've played it a bit. The free version actually isn't that bad, basically the premium version lets you tweak the difficulty a bit more, as far as I know there isn't any timegates / stamina but the free version does have ads. Here's what I said about it a few pages back:

Gavinvin posted:

No its actually a pretty decent (but with a learning curve) survival sim. I've played the free version and decided to pick up the premium version while its cheap. Beyond all the perks mentioned in the store for the premium version (like removing ads, giving you some loot at the start) it also gives you access to "Medium" difficulty mode. The free version only lets you play sandbox (easy) or realistic (hard).

I would suggest you try the free version first, as its completely playable (once you get over the learning curve) without needing any of the premium features, then pick up the premium version if you like it.
